How to Make Sweetpotato Sausage Bake

Now that you have your ingredients ready, let’s dive into making this delicious Sweetpotato Sausage Bake!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a hearty meal on the table in no time.

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

First things first, pre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Preheating is crucial because it ensures that your dish cooks evenly. A hot oven helps the sweet potatoes caramelize beautifully, giving them that irresistible flavor.

Step 2: Prepare the Ingredients

Next, let’s get those sweet potatoes and veggies ready! Peel and dice the sweet potatoes into bite-sized pieces. Aim for uniformity; this helps them cook evenly. Chop the bell pepper and onion into similar-sized pieces. The garlic should be minced finely to release its aromatic goodness. Trust me, this prep work pays off!

Step 3: Combine Ingredients

In a large bowl, combine the diced sweet potatoes, sausage, bell pepper, onion, and garlic. Drizzle with olive oil and sprinkle paprika, salt, and pepper over the top. Toss everything together until well-coated. This step is key! An even coating ensures that every bite is bursting with flavor.

Step 4: Spread on Baking Sheet

Now, spread the mixture evenly on a baking sheet. Make sure not to overcrowd the pan; this allows the ingredients to roast rather than steam. If you have a large batch, consider using two sheets. A little space goes a long way in achieving that perfect golden-brown finish!

Step 5: Bake to Perfection

Pop the baking sheet into the pre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es. Halfway through, give it a good stir to ensure even cooking. You’ll know it’s done when the sweet potatoes are tender and the sausage is cooked through. A fork should easily pierce the sweet potatoes!

Step 6: Garnish and Serve

Once out of the oven, let your Sweetpotato Sausage Bake cool for a minute. Then, garnish with fresh parsley for a pop of color and freshness. Serve it hot, and watch your family dig in with delight. Presentation matters, so consider serving it in a colorful bowl or on a rustic platter for that extra touch!

Tips for Success

  • Always use a sharp knife for easy and safe chopping.
  • For extra flavor, let the sausage sit at room temperature for 15 minutes before cooking.
  • Don’t skip the stirring halfway through baking; it promotes even cooking.
  • Experiment with different spices like cumin or thyme for a unique twist.
  •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to three days.

Variations

  • Vegetarian Option: Swap the sausage for plant-based sausage or chickpeas for a hearty, meat-free meal.
  • Spicy Kick: Use spicy sausage or add diced jalapeños for an extra layer of heat.
  • Herb Infusion: Experiment with fresh herbs like rosemary or thyme for a fragrant twist.
  • Cheesy Delight: Sprinkle shredded cheese on top during the last 5 minutes of baking for a melty finish.
  • Root Vegetable Medley: Mix in other root vegetables like parsnips or carrots for added flavor and nutrition.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 large sweet potatoes, peeled and diced
  • 1 pound sausage (Italian or your choice)
  • 1 bell pepper, chopped
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ley for garnish

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. In a large bowl, combine the diced sweet potatoes, sausage, bell pepper, onion, and garlic.
  3. Drizzle with olive oil and sprinkle with paprika, salt, and pepper. Toss to coat.
  4. Spread the mixture evenly on a baking sheet.
  5.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the sweet potatoes are tender and the sausage is cooked through.
  6. Garnish with fresh parsley before serving.

Notes

  • Feel free to add other vegetables like zucchini or carrots.
  • This dish can be made ahead and reheated for a quick meal.
  • Adjust the spice level by using spicy sausage or adding red pepper flakes.
